How to Repair and Maintain Your Credit Score (CIBIL)

Why Credit Scores Matter

Your credit score (CIBIL) is the first filter banks check. A score of 750+ qualifies you for the best interest rates, while a poor score can lead to loan rejections.

Steps to Repair Your Score

Ensure 100% timely EMI and credit card payments. Maintain your Credit Utilization Ratio below 30% of your limit, and resolve any discrepancies on your credit report.

Healthy Credit Habits

Avoid applying for multiple loans simultaneously, as this triggers hard inquiries that lower your score. Regularly monitor your credit report to spot errors.
